#!/usr/bin/env python
# 12.01.2007, c
"""
Solve partial differential equations given in a SfePy problem definition file.
Example problem definition files can be found in ``sfepy/examples/`` directory
of the SfePy top-level directory.
The supported application kinds (--app option) are:
- bvp - boundary value problem. Example::
python3 simple.py sfepy/examples/diffusion/poisson.py
- homogen - calculation of local microscopic problems (correctors) and
homogenized coefficients. Example::
python3 simple.py sfepy/examples/homogenization/perfusion_micro.py
- bvp-mM - micro-macro boundary value problem. Solve a coupled two-scale
problem in parallel using MPI. One computational node is solving a
macroscopic equation while the others are solving local microscopic problems
and homogenized coefficients. The --app option is required in this case.
Example::
mpiexec -n 4 python3 simple.py --app=bvp-mM --debug-mpi sfepy/examples/homogenization/nonlinear_hyperelastic_mM.py
- evp - eigenvalue problem. Example::
python3 simple.py sfepy/examples/quantum/well.py
- phonon - phononic band gaps. Example::
python3 simple.py sfepy/examples/phononic/band_gaps.py --phonon-plot
Both normal and parametric study runs are supported. A parametric study allows
repeated runs for varying some of the simulation parameters - see
``sfepy/examples/diffusion/poisson_parametric_study.py`` file.
"""
from __future__ import print_function
from __future__ import absolute_import
from argparse import ArgumentParser, RawDescriptionHelpFormatter
import sfepy
from sfepy.base.base import output, Struct
from sfepy.base.conf import ProblemConf, get_standard_keywords
from sfepy.applications import PDESolverApp, EVPSolverApp
def print_terms():
import sfepy.terms as t
tt = t.term_table
print('Terms: %d available:' % len(tt))
print(sorted(tt.keys()))
def print_solvers():
from sfepy.solvers import solver_table
print('Solvers: %d available:' % len(solver_table))
print(sorted(solver_table.keys()))
helps = {
'app' :
'override application kind, normally determined automatically.'
' The supported kinds are:'
' bvp (boundary value problem),'
' homogen (correctors, homogenized coefficients),'
' bvp-mM (micro-macro boundary value problem,'
' homogenized coefficients computed in parallel using MPI),'
' evp (eigenvalue problem),'
' phonon (phononic band gaps)',
'debug':
'automatically start debugger when an exception is raised',
'debug_mpi': 'log MPI communication (mM mode only)',
'conf' :
'override problem description file items, written as python'
' dictionary without surrounding braces',
'options' : 'override options item of problem description,'
' written as python dictionary without surrounding braces',
'define' : 'pass given arguments written as python dictionary'
' without surrounding braces to define() function of problem description'
' file',
'filename' :
'basename of output file(s) [default: <basename of input file>]',
'output_format' :
'output file format, one of: {vtk, h5} [default: vtk]',
'save_restart' :
'if given, save restart files according to the given mode.',
'load_restart' :
'if given, load the given restart file',
'log' :
'log all messages to specified file (existing file will be overwritten!)',
'quiet' :
'do not print any messages to screen',
'save_ebc' :
'save a zero solution with applied EBCs (Dirichlet boundary conditions)',
'save_ebc_nodes' :
'save a zero solution with added non-zeros in EBC (Dirichlet boundary'
' conditions) nodes - scalar variables are shown using colors,'
' vector variables using arrows with non-zero components corresponding'
' to constrained components',
'save_regions' :
'save problem regions as meshes',
'save_regions_as_groups' :
'save problem regions in a single mesh but mark them by using different'
' element/node group numbers',
'save_field_meshes' :
'save meshes of problem fields (with extra DOF nodes)',
'solve_not' :
'do not solve (use in connection with --save-*)',
'detect_band_gaps' :
'detect frequency band gaps',
'analyze_dispersion' :
'analyze dispersion properties (low frequency domain)',
'plot' :
'plot frequency band gaps, assumes -b',
'phase_velocity' :
'compute phase velocity (frequency-independent mass only)',
'list' :
'list data, what can be one of: {terms, solvers}',
}
